It’s continued to be a big year for this 2017 RealLIST company: Center City health IT startup Oncora Medical announced it had raised $3 million and entered a partnership with a California-based medtech company last month. The software company spent 16 weeks earlier this year at an accelerator at the Texas Medical Center Innovation Institute in Houston, where it has a full-time staff member. […]

Tech startup TrekIT Health is moving forward in efforts to get its Penn-grown, patient-focused workflow software into other health systems, securing fresh funding and naming a new CEO. The Philadelphia-based company said co-founder Dr. Subha Airan Javia is taking over as its top executive from former CEO Brendan McCorkle. The C-suite shift comes as the […]
